Abstract
Laboratory studies are designed to define, in terms of food consumption, bioenergetics, and growth of fish, the temperature conditions to which fish can adapt physiologically. Model stream studies simulate conditions of elevated temperature to which fish and other organisms may be exposed in natural streams. The stream experiments are designed to evaluate the effects of a modified temperature regime on important ecological relationships in an aquatic community. (Author)
